Alternative Financing Options
In South Africa, several dealerships and private sellers offer alternative financing solutions. These options typically bypass traditional credit checks and instead focus on affordability and proof of income. Customers are required to demonstrate their ability to meet monthly payments rather than relying on their credit history. This approach opens up opportunities for individuals with bad credit or no credit history at all.
Rent-to-Own Programs
One of the popular options available is the rent-to-own program. These programs allow customers to rent an SUV with the option to purchase it after a predetermined period. Payments made during the rental term often contribute towards the final purchase price. According to IDM, this arrangement provides flexibility and a clear path to ownership without requiring a traditional loan.
In-House Financing
Some dealerships provide in-house financing options tailored to individuals with poor credit scores. By financing the purchase internally, dealerships minimize reliance on banks and credit checks. Peer-to-Peer Lending
Peer-to-peer lending platforms can also be considered for those in search of an SUV without bank checks. These platforms connect borrowers directly with private lenders willing to finance vehicle purchases. Considerations Before Committing
While these options provide viable alternatives to traditional financing, it's crucial to understand the terms and conditions thoroughly. Interest rates can be higher, and failure to meet payment obligations might result in repossession. Evaluating personal financial circumstances and exploring all available options are essential steps towards making a sound decision.
